Transaction dc3fed66f91e47fd37413a6a917eb6220e95162bcc70fe73f20f707666159dfa

block
3705cd77cf9e2350b66b85dae3f634aecdcd9ab4c904a04ff9c3cd45d8a95857

1 Input

2 Outputs